Easy to install

Integrated larder fridges are the perfect addition to any kitchen. They fit seamlessly behind the cabinet doors of a kitchen for a streamlined look. It can be difficult to replace or install one. It's because there are numerous parts that must be arranged and attached. This can be a challenge for those who have never done it before. With a little planning and attention, the process can be made much easier.

Before you begin to install your integrated fridge ensure that it is placed away from the cooker and any other sources of heat. Avoid placing it in damp areas. You should also be careful not to place it too close to electrical outlets, because this could affect its performance. For airflow and ventilation you should leave 3 to 4mm gap between the fridge freezers and cabinet wall on the non-hinged side.

The next step is to install the supply line. This can be done using a saddle valve or a compression fitting. Saddle valves can be tightened by turning a nut until the pipe is broken. Compression fittings operate similarly but they utilize a threaded tube to connect to the refrigerator. After you've finished the process, you can connect your refrigerator and put away any excess tubing to prevent it from getting pinched or entrapped.

At minimum four hours following the installation before plugging in your refrigerator. It is essential to wait for this period because it allows the chemicals in the compressor to settle. Your fridge won't cool as quickly If you don't take this step.

It is advisable to have two people present when you are ready to install of your refrigerator. Each person should hold a side of the appliance and slowly move it into its opening. Once the appliance is positioned, be sure to leave an airflow and ventilation gap in the back.

Easy to maintain

Larder refrigerators with integrated larders are an excellent method to keep food fresh and tidily organized without affecting the appearance of your kitchen. You can choose from a range of sizes and finishes to find the perfect one for your kitchen. They are also simple to clean, which means you can keep your food fresher for longer.

You can choose an integrated refrigerator with or without an the ice box. The refrigerator that has an Ice Box is typically larger, but it has less space for food than an integrated fridge without one. An integrated refrigerator is the best choice for those who want a sleek and modern look for their kitchen.

In addition to ensuring that your fridge is clean and organized It is also important to perform routine maintenance on it. This will help keep your food safe and fresh to eat, and will help you save money on electricity costs. Go through the owner's manual for maintenance tips if you aren't sure how to maintain your refrigerator. Most manuals provide troubleshooting tips for common problems that will allow you to resolve the issue yourself prior to calling a professional.

russell-hobbs-rh142cf2002-142l-freestanding-white-chest-freezer-with-5-year-warranty-adjustable-thermostat-4-star-freezer-rating-suitable-for-outbuildings-garages-237.jpgStart by unplugging the refrigerator. Then, wash the removable parts with a cleaning product. The ideal solution is to use a natural cleaning product. A mixture of equal parts warm water and vinegar is a great option, but you can also use bicarbonate of soda. After you've finished, wash the fridge and dry it thoroughly with a towel or a cloth towel.

Next, you'll want to remove the coils and then vacuum under your fridge. The owner's manual will have instructions for this, but you can also use a coil brush to access the areas that are difficult to reach. Once you've done this you should note down on your calendar to clean your coils in the next six months.

Last but not least, clean the doors and handles of your refrigerator. They can be hot spots for germs, so it's important to wipe them down often with a sanitizing liquid. You can also disinfect shelves and drawers with an equal amount of white vinegar to 2 parts hot water.
